## Service accounts — Calsync conflict resolver

The Calsync conflict resolver runs under a dedicated service account, not a user identity. Reviewers: reject any PR that swaps in personal credentials. The account has read access to the Tideboard calendar store and write access only to the conflicts table. Conflict resolution is idempotent; reruns are safe. Token refresh is handled by the Keyhold sidecar, so no rotation logic belongs in app code. The current staging service-account key is listed below.

service key, fawip-bajef: kto11_Qt5wZK9vdNC

## Retention Sweeper Stuck?

The Tidewater sweeper runs nightly at 02:15 and prunes anything past its retention window in the archive buckets. If the `sweeper_lag_hours` metric climbs past 12, first check whether the previous run is still holding the lock — it often is, and killing the stale job fixes things. Don't bump the batch size without talking to the storage folks first. Full step-by-step recovery instructions, including the lock-release procedure, are on the internal runbook page.

operations page: https://jenkins.zemvarcloud.local/job/merge_requests/repo/build/73930b4b30f0a8ed

## Deployment

Fieldspan Gateway ingests telemetry from Harrowdale tractors and balers over MQTT and forwards normalized frames to your plugin's webhook. Plugins run out-of-process; the gateway never loads your code directly. Deploy the gateway as a single container per barn site. It requires a writable spool directory and outbound access to the Fieldspan relay. Plugins register at startup and must ack frames within five seconds or the frame is requeued. The gateway starts with the configuration values given below.

settings of tahag-tahag:
[istdor]
host = istdor.tolvaqcorp.corp
user = istdor_svc
database = istdor_prod

## Build Provenance: Flaky DNS in Quillhopper CI

Heads up: the Quillhopper build agents occasionally fail to resolve the internal artifact mirror, so provenance attestations get stamped with a retry flag. It's not corruption — just the resolver timing out mid-handshake. If you see duplicate attestation entries, keep the later one. For verification, compare the retry flag against the token recorded below.

pipeline stamp: htk4_ae36